Etymology edit
di- (“sensory”) + -◌́- (ni-modal 3rd person subject prefix) + -∅- (classifier) + -kʼǫ́ǫ́zh (neuter perfective stem of root -KʼǪSH, “to be sour, spoiled”).

Usage notes edit
This verb is semantically limited to expression in the third person.
This is a neuter verb that uses only the perfective mode.
